Sep 17, 2016Travis (probably Mike Dean) did a good job sequencing this album and maintaining an aesthetic/vibe throughout. On paper, it's a much better listen front-to-back than Rodeo, which other than the stretch from Oh My Dis Side to Night Call is sequenced terribly. But Travis is so irredeemably boring 95% of the time that it doesn't matter. I've listened to this album probably five times and I don't remember a single line Travis said on this entire album besides 'stroke my cactus' and the part where he gives a nod to Day N Nite. I've never heard another album that's sequenced and maintains a sound this well that has such lackluster individual songs. It's actually kind of baffling to me. Even if Rodeo is a terrible listen front-to-back and Travis still isn't that interesting, the star-studded guest line up and the grandiose production makes each song feel like an event. How can you borrow this much from Kanye, Future, Young Thug, Rae Sremmurd (and h---, even Kid Cudi) and have nothing to show for it?

I get that 100%, I'm not a person who only values "bars" in rap. I can appreciate why someone would enjoy this for its atmosphere. The thing that bothers me about it is Travis tries so hard to be an 'artist' with his music but it doesn't feel like his art in any sense. The first time I really listened to Monster and enjoyed it a lot of what I was listening for was for the aesthetic, but even then before I was fluent in understanding Future's crooning it felt personal to Future himself. It felt like it was his. You get no sense of that with Travis, which is fine, but he tries to paint himself as something he's not.furface, Ordinary Joel, Chad Warden and 1 other person like this. -
